Output 51fc255c09c3f900b56390dc113c17968656042723eabc9402d4e82d4c3b285c:1

value
99063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27d9bbcdef01491d6a3293b0b9b231446b7576a6 OP_EQUAL
address
35Kj7RQhV3oj9fuCuHwy2wFqaufBK7CoXG
transaction
51fc255c09c3f900b56390dc113c17968656042723eabc9402d4e82d4c3b285c
spent
true